Is your Fisher & Paykel oven not functioning? If it shows no response to controls, lacks heating, and has no display, you may be facing power supply issues or a faulty control board. Understanding the causes can help you troubleshoot effectively.

Urgency: Medium

Important Tips for Fisher & Paykel Models

  • Oven will not operate until electronic clock/timer is set on models with an electronic clock.
  • Display not turning on may be addressed by power cycling the main power supply.

Possible Causes

No power to the oven

How to Identify: No lights or display; display blank; check house circuit breaker and wall switch.

Part: House electrical supply / mains connection

Oven clock not set (electronic models)

How to Identify: Display shows 0:00 or blank but power present; oven won’t start until clock is set.

Part: Electronic clock/timer module

Defective electronic control board

How to Identify: Oven has power (display lights up but no response to inputs; no heating.

Part: Electronic control board

Cracked igniter (gas models)

How to Identify: For gas ovens: display may function but burner does not ignite.

Part: Igniter

Bad control thermostat

How to Identify: Oven may not heat or start; thermostat may fail to signal correct temperature control.

Part: Control thermostat

DIY Solutions

Verify power supply and breaker

Easy 5–10 minutes
Tools Needed: None
  1. Check that the oven’s wall switch and circuit breaker are turned on.
  2. Confirm the oven’s mains power supply is connected and not tripped.
  3. Observe whether the display or interior light powers on after resetting breaker.
⚠️ Safety First: Do not touch electrical components with wet hands.

Set the clock on electronic models

Easy 5 minutes
Tools Needed: None
  1. Locate the clock/timer controls on the oven.
  2. Follow manufacturer instructions to set current time.
  3. Attempt to start oven after clock is set.

Power reset (basic control reboot)

Easy 10 minutes
Tools Needed: None
  1. Turn off power at main switch or breaker.
  2. Wait 5 minutes to allow control boards to discharge.
  3. Turn power back on to reset control electronics and try to operate oven.
⚠️ Safety First: Ensure no children operate oven during power reset.

When to Call a Professional

Oven has power but no heating or control response
Igniter or thermostat suspected defective
Repeated breaker trips when oven is powered

Preventive Maintenance

  • Regularly verify circuit breaker and connections: Loss of power due to tripped breakers or loose connections
    Frequency: annually
  • Keep control panel clean and dry: Unresponsive controls due to grime or moisture
    Frequency: monthly
